I picked up the subject card for my Razr Maxx, and it is working fine in the phone. I copied my music from the 16GB SD card I had in my DINC to my ASUS win7 machine. The music is fine on the hard drive and they all play. When copying them to the new card, whether the card is in the phone and connected as USB Mass Storage, or in the adapter and plugged into the card slot on the computer, I get errors.

It either just hangs copying, or pops up a window telling me there are issues with the card and offers the option of continuing or scanning and trying to correct errors. If I tell it to scan and check for bad sectors, it never finds any.

I had no problems copying pictures and documents to the card in the same manner.

Any one else run into problems copying music to one of these class 10 cards?
